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 25-09-2003, 09:07   #1 (permalink)
Neuer User
 
Registriert seit: Sep 2003
Beiträge: 9
variable Instance Namen in Funktion?

moin, moin

ich versuche gerade variable filme anzusteuern. ich stecke tief in meinen instanzen und kann keinen befehl finden, der mx zwingt nicht "x" als filmnamen sondern als variable zu lesen.


_level0.inhalte1.inhalte2.inhalte3.x.gotoAndStop(5 );

kann mir vielleicht einer von euch helfen?

vielen dank im voraus

Tim
rufusTim ist offline   Mit Zitat antworten
Alt 25-09-2003, 09:15   #2 (permalink)
Mit ohne "F"
 
Benutzerbild von slashmaster
 
Registriert seit: Nov 2002
Ort: Dresden
Beiträge: 1.051
es ist sowieso angebrachter eindeutige namen zu verwenden....

da es sonst zu verständigungsprobs (wie in deinem fall) kommen kann..
__________________
Gruß Markus!

ActionScript:
  1. /*Kreativität entsteht durch
  2. Bewegung, Zerlegung alter Regeln
  3. und neuen Überlegungen*/
slashmaster ist offline   Mit Zitat antworten
Alt 25-09-2003, 09:21   #3 (permalink)
Alter User
 
Benutzerbild von norg
 
Registriert seit: Sep 2002
Ort: Colonia
Beiträge: 447
ActionScript:
  1. _level0.inhalte1.inhalte2.inhalte3[$variable].tuWas
  2. //
  3. // oder
  4. //
  5. _level0.inhalte1.inhalte2.inhalte3["instanzNamensTeil_" + $variable].tuAuchWas

Wichtig: vor den eckigen Klammern kein Punkt, nach den Klammer Punkt

Grussw

N O R G
norg ist offline   Mit Zitat antworten
Alt 25-09-2003, 09:22   #4 (permalink)
Neuer User
 
Registriert seit: Sep 2003
Beiträge: 9
die namen der movie clips sind schon eindeutig, doch variabel nach der auswahl aus der combobox.

mit trace(x); kann ich sie ja dort ja auch auslesen.

Geändert von rufusTim (25-09-2003 um 09:24 Uhr)
rufusTim ist offline   Mit Zitat antworten
Alt 25-09-2003, 09:34   #5 (permalink)
Alter User
 
Benutzerbild von norg
 
Registriert seit: Sep 2002
Ort: Colonia
Beiträge: 447
versteh ich nicht - was ist fest was ist variabel? und was willst du machen?
norg ist offline   Mit Zitat antworten
Alt 25-09-2003, 10:00   #6 (permalink)
Neuer User
 
Registriert seit: Sep 2003
Beiträge: 9
es soll eine art internetseite werden, mit 3 comboboxen, die alle voneinander abhängig sind, steuere ich den inhalt. bei der letzten combobox wurden es aber für meinen geschmack in der programmierung zu umfangreich jeden einzelnen inhalt (16x40x7 movie clips) anzusteuern. also erstellte ich eine liste mit den instance namen der movie clips. diese kann ich auslesen und dann mit x.gotoAndStop(y) ansteuern. das war die idee.

leider kann mx anscheinend nicht zwischen variabel als instance name unterscheiden, wenn es mitten in einem pfadangabe steht.

so steuere ich durch die ebenen mit _level0.inhalt1.inhalt2.inhalt3 (das sind die unterebenen), dann kommt der variable instance name x (movie clip), dann die funktion gotoAndStop(irgendwo);.
rufusTim ist offline   Mit Zitat antworten
Alt 25-09-2003, 10:08   #7 (permalink)
Neuer User
 
Benutzerbild von JustLearning
 
Registriert seit: Dec 2002
Beiträge: 337
jep nog hat es schon richtig geschrieben
_level0.inhalte1.inhalte2.inhalte3[$variable].tuWas
damit sollte es gehen.
JustLearning ist offline   Mit Zitat antworten
Alt 25-09-2003, 10:22   #8 (permalink)
Neuer User
 
Registriert seit: Sep 2003
Beiträge: 9
leider geht das hier nicht...
gibt es noch einen anderen weg?
rufusTim 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 09:16 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ele